International Camellia Register
ICR
Home/ Photos/ 592e043b-4feb-21c1-254e-08a691269586

Triomphe de WondelgemFlowersLeaves

Triomphe de Wondelgem, Flowers, Leaves

Name  Triomphe de Wondelgem 
Title3XtvB-021
Location
Copyright
Resolution2175×3276
Created
Uploaded21 Jan, 2021

Identify

Only invited VIP user could revise the above Name.